New to Challengertalk - from Central Indiana

Hello everyone,
I have a 2010 R/T Classic that I have had for a year now.

I saw my first new gen Challenger almost two years ago, and I was a fan instantly. I always wanted to one day restore a true classic muscle car, or invest in one already done, but the new Challengers came first.

Funny thing is, that I was never a Mopar fanatic by any stretch, and my very first car was a '69 Camaro. But Barracudas, Road Runners and Chargers were among my favorite muscle cars of the late 60's and early 70's.

Having a modern-day muscle car means I don't need to recreate one now from deteriorating historic remains, and I can get the style and appeal of old school muscle with the handling and conveniences of modern day engineering.

The R/T Challenger reincarnated, was just a brilliant concept!

Welcome! I am in Fishers, so not too far away. There are some other central Indiana folks on here, but not a lot. A couple years ago, I tried to form a sub group of locals and plan a meet and greet, but did not find enough interest. May be worth trying again.

Often on Satuday evenings, we take our Challenger up to the square in Noblesville. A lot of folks bring out their classic cars (some modern cars as well) and hang out. We usually park for a bit, open the hood, walk around, and grab an ice cream at Alexanders.

I think there is still "cars and coffee" on Saturday AMs at the McAllisters on 96th and Meridian as well. I have only gone once, since it hard to get my family moving early on a Saturday.

Anyways, hope to meet up with you at some point - take care.
